How Our Laminate Floor Water Extraction Service Works
At our company, we understand the importance of a proper process with laminate floor water extraction. Our team follows a meticulous process to ensure that your floors are restored to their original condition. We’ll start by assessing the damage and developing a customized plan to extract the water, dry the area, and restore your floors. Our technicians use the latest equipment and techniques to ensure a thorough and efficient process.
Step 1: Assessment and Planning
We’ll send a trained technician to your home to assess the damage and develop a customized plan to extract the water and dry the area. We’ll identify the source of the water and find out the best course of action to prevent further damage.
Step 2: Water Extraction
Our technicians will use specialized equipment to extract the water from your laminate flooring. We’ll use a combination of wet vacuums and pumps to remove as much water as possible from the affected area.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
Once the water has been extracted, our technicians will use specialized equipment to dry and dehumidify the area. We’ll use industrial-grade fans and dehumidifiers to speed up the drying process and prevent further damage.
Step 4: Cleaning and Disinfection
After the area has been dried, our technicians will clean and disinfect the area to prevent the growth of mold and mildew. We’ll use eco-friendly cleaning products to ensure a safe and healthy environment for your family.
Step 5: Restoration and Finishing
Once the area has been cleaned and disinfected, our technicians will restore your laminate flooring to its original condition. We’ll use specialized equipment and techniques to ensure a seamless finish and prevent further damage.

Warning Signs You Need Laminate Floor Water Extraction
Water damage can be sneaky, and it’s essential to catch the warning signs early to prevent further damage. Here are some common warning signs that you need laminate floor water extraction:
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
If you notice a musty smell in your home that won’t go away, it could be a sign of water damage. Don’t ignore the smell as it can lead to mold and mildew growth.
Warped or Buckled Flooring
If your laminate flooring is warped or buckled, it’s a sign that water has seeped into the flooring. Don’t delay as this can lead to further damage and costly repairs.
Water Stains on the Ceiling or Walls
Water stains on the ceiling or walls can be a sign of water damage. Don’t ignore the stains as they can lead to further damage and costly repairs.
Visible Water Damage on the Floor
Visible water damage on the floor is a clear sign that you need laminate floor water extraction. Don’t delay as this can lead to further damage and costly repairs.
Increased Humidity or Condensation
Increased humidity or condensation in your home can be a sign of water damage. Don’t ignore the humidity as it can lead to mold and mildew growth.
Cracks in the Foundation or Walls
Cracks in the foundation or walls can be a sign of water damage. Don’t delay as this can lead to further damage and costly repairs.

Laminate Floor Water Extraction Cost in Veguita, NM
The cost of laminate floor water extraction in Veguita, NM, can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Our team provides free estimates and transparent pricing to help you budget for the repairs. We’ll work with you to find a solution that fits your budget.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water extraction and drying | $500 – $2,500 | Size of affected area, severity of damage, and local conditions |
| Dehumidification and cleaning | $200 – $1,000 | Size of affected area, severity of damage, and local conditions |
| Restoration and finishing | $1,000 – $5,000 | Size of affected area, severity of damage, and local conditions |
| Free estimates and consultation | $0 – $100 | Size of affected area and severity of damage |
